Attah Igala Palace Secretary Dismisses Viral Video by One Ogala Comedian ,MC Enebo-Ojojo as Malicious and Unsubstantiated*
Rebuttal of False and Malicious Allegations Circulating on Social Media*
My attention has been drawn to a viral video made by an Igala Comedian known as MC “Enebojo-jo", containing false allegations against my person and my office as Secretary of the Attah Igala Palace, Idah.
I categorically state that the claims, including the allegation of a threat to the life of the Onu Igala Anambra, are entirely unfounded, malicious, and intended to damage my reputation and that of the palace. I have no personal or business relationship with the said traditional ruler that would warrant such a threat.
As Secretary to the Attah Igala, part of my official role is to interface with traditional rulers and facilitate communication between the palace and other stakeholders. The phone call in question was made strictly in line with this duty, to invite the Onu Igala Anambra to the palace for consultation. It is regrettable that the comedian misrepresented this official engagement and used it to spread unfounded allegations against the palace and my office.
The palace of the Attah Igala has established traditional channels for addressing grievances and verifying serious matters concerning the institution. Resorting to social media to peddle unverified claims undermines these processes and brings the revered institution into disrepute.
I call on the individual to refrain from these orchestrated plans to tarnish the image of the palace. If he is truly an Igala son, he should uphold the values of our people, who have never engaged in such conduct of public defamation against their traditional institution.
I urge the public, particularly the Igala people, to disregard the video and its contents. I remain committed to upholding the dignity of the Attah Igala Palace and serving the Igala people with integrity.
*Signed*
Jibrin Omale Onuche
Secretary, Attah Igala Palace, Idah
